The Key Findings: What Truly Extends Your Pug’s Lifespan?
The study identifies five pivotal elements proven to enhance Chinese Pug longevity:
-
Precision Nutrition Tailored to Brachycephalic Dogs
Due to their flat-faced anatomy, Chinese Pugs face unique health challenges like respiratory issues and overheating risks. The research recommends a balanced, calorie-controlled diet rich in joint-supporting nutrients and omega-3s. Avoiding high-calorie snacks and obesity-high risk diets is critical. -
Regular, Gentle Exercise with Injury Prevention
While Pugs love short walks and play sessions, excessive high-impact activity strains their joints. The study advocates low-impact exercises like swimming and controlled leash walks to maintain fitness without back harm.

Advanced Dental Care
Studies link poor dental hygiene to systemic diseases—especially in brachycephalic breeds prone to oral infections. Daily tooth brushing and vet-approved cleanings emerged as vital to preventing systemic complications. -
Routine Veterinary Monitoring and Early Detection
Chinese Pugs are predisposed to conditions like tracheal collapse, eye diseases, and heart abnormalities. Annual check-ups focusing on airway health, ocular exams, and cardiac screenings are essential. Early detection improves treatment outcomes significantly. -
Mental Stimulation and Emotional Well-being
Chronic stress shortens lifespan in dogs. The study emphasizes consistent socialization, puzzle toys, and interactive play to keep Pugs emotionally healthy, reducing anxiety and supporting overall vitality.
Practical Tips to Apply the Breakthroughs Today
- Adjust Diet Smartly: Consult your vet for a customized dog food plan focusing on joint health and controlled portions.
- Start Exercise Gradually: Use short, regular walks and integrate swimming—ideal for Pugs’ breathing sensitivity.
- Prioritize Dental Care: Brush teeth 2–3 times weekly and schedule professional cleanings every 6–12 months.
- Watch for Early Symptoms: Be alert to coughing, difficulty breathing, or lethargy; prompt vet visits catch issues early.
- Make Mental Play a Daily Habit: Use food puzzles or hide-and-seek games to keep their mind sharp and engaged.
